Penpie hackers exchanged stolen assets for 11,109 ETH, part of which has been transferred to Tornado Cash

According to BlockBeats, on September 4, according to Ember monitoring, Penpie was hacked and assets worth US$27.8 million were stolen due to a security vulnerability, mainly some LRT assets (wstETH/agETH/rswETH, etc.).

Most of the stolen assets were exchanged by hackers for 11,109 ETH (about 26.95 million US dollars), of which 1,000 ETH (about 2.42 million US dollars) was laundered by hackers through Tornado Cash 1 hour ago.

The initial funds from the address used by the hacker to steal assets were also received from Tornado.
